2. Neo Needle Specifications and Medical Applications
2.1 Technical Specifications: Gauges, Lengths, and Materials
Neo Nano Needles, manufactured by Neogenesis Co., Ltd. in South Korea, are CE-certified for professional use. Their engineering emphasizes smooth penetration and consistent performance.
| Parameter | Details |
|---|---|
| Gauge | 30G, 33G, 34G (ultra-thin options) |
| Length | 4mm, 6mm, 13mm (varies by gauge) |
| Material | Stainless steel |
| Certification | CE-certified |
| Quantity per pack | 100 needles |
- 30G: Available in 4mm and 13mm, suitable for short, high-precision injections and deeper placements.
- 33G: Offered in 4mm, 6mm, and 13mm, providing broad procedural flexibility.
- 34G: Comes in 4mm and 6mm, ideal for ultra-superficial work.
Material and build: High-grade stainless steel with a polished surface enables gentle entry and helps lower tissue trauma, making insertion feel nearly effortless for trained users.
Pain and swelling considerations: Finer gauges (30G, 33G, 34G) are linked with significantly less pain, bleeding, and swelling than thicker conventional needles, supporting smoother recoveries and higher patient satisfaction.
Certification and quality: CE certification confirms adherence to strict European standards. Neo needles undergo rigorous trials for reliability in sensitive aesthetic procedures.
2.2 Clinical Applications in Aesthetic Medicine
Mesotherapy: Optimized for hyaluronic acid delivery to address hydration, texture, and fine lines—key elements in rejuvenation protocols.
Biorevitalization: Enables precise administration of vitamins, peptides, and other actives. Fine gauges promote even spread with minimal trauma for natural-looking outcomes.
Botox and collagen injections: Smooth insertion and accurate placement reduce bruising risk and help produce consistent results.
Local anesthetics: Ultra-thin designs improve comfort during anesthetic delivery, shaping a better experience for the entire procedure.
Hyaluronic acid absorption and trauma minimization: The nano-channel effect supports product uptake while micro-openings minimize trauma, swelling, and bruising.
Clinical trends: Many practitioners are shifting from traditional microneedling to nano-needle techniques targeting the epidermis, reducing downtime and post-procedure issues—especially effective for hydration-focused treatments.
Professional use only: These devices are intended strictly for certified professionals; self-administration is contraindicated due to risk of infection or poor technique.

6. Safety Protocols and Contraindications
6.1 Handling Procedures and Complication Management
Follow strict, standardized protocols to protect patients and staff:
- One-handed recapping: Mandatory to prevent needlestick injuries; avoid two-handed techniques.
- Puncture-resistant disposal: Discard in labeled sharps containers, never beyond three-quarters full.
- Avoid tissue coring: Use styletted needles to reduce dermal plug introduction in procedures like caudal blocks.
Procedure-specific guidance:
- Pediatric anesthesia:
- 22-gauge needle for children aged one year and older.
- 25-gauge needle for infants under one year.
- Prefer angiocatheters over butterfly needles for caudal blocks to detect intravascular placement and reduce vascular complications.
- Pneumothorax aspiration:
- Avoid butterfly needles due to lung laceration risk.
- Use angiocatheters (16–22 gauge) or specialized thoracentesis systems.
Complication management: Watch for vascular issues (e.g., dissection, rupture) and dermatologic risks such as erythema or hyperpigmentation, particularly post-microneedling.
6.2 Absolute and Relative Contraindications
Conduct a thorough medical history and medication review to screen out high-risk patients.
| Condition/Medication | Risk |
|---|---|
| Active skin infections | Spread of infection, worsened inflammation |
| Blood clotting disorders | Excessive bleeding from punctures |
| Keloid history | Hypertrophic scarring post-procedure |
| Autoimmune/collagen vascular diseases | Unpredictable tissue reactions |
| Anticoagulant therapy | Increased bleeding risk |
| Chemotherapy/radiotherapy | Compromised skin integrity |
| Metallic implants/pacemakers (RF microneedling) | Potential energy interference |
Adverse effects to monitor:
| Effect | Incidence/Description |
|---|---|
| Pruritus | Noted in pediatric epidural patients |
| Nausea/vomiting | Occurs in pediatric epidural cases |
| Urinary retention | Seen in pediatric epidural use |
| Erythema | Common post-microneedling, resolves quickly |
| Post-inflammatory hyperpigmentation | Higher risk in non-Fitzpatrick skin types |
Special considerations:
- RF microneedling: Contraindicated with active acne, herpes, or eczema.
- Caudal analgesia: Short-bevel Tuohy needles help detect ligament puncture and avoid complications.
Key trends: Adoption of safety-engineered devices (e.g., angiocatheters, needleless systems) continues to reduce sharps injuries. Microneedling may be preferred in darker skin types due to lower dyspigmentation risk versus ablative procedures.

8. Frequently Asked Questions (FAQ)
8.1 Q: What is the difference between 30G and 33G Neo needles?
A: 30G is slightly thicker and fits both short, high-precision injections (e.g., 4mm) and deeper applications (13mm). 33G is finer and ideal where minimal trauma is critical, available in 4mm, 6mm, and 13mm. Both provide smooth insertion with reduced pain.
8.2 Q: For which procedures is the 4mm Neo needle length ideal?
A: The 4mm length is designed for short, high-precision injections in sensitive or superficial areas, including mesotherapy, Botox, and other cosmetic procedures where accuracy and low tissue trauma are priorities.
8.3 Q: How can I verify the sterility of Neo needle packaging?
A: Sterile Neo needles are individually packaged with clear labeling. Confirm intact packaging and visible sterility indicators before use, and follow the manufacturer’s instructions.
8.4 Q: What is the recommended approach for managing post-procedure erythema?
A: Mild erythema is common after microneedling or injectables and typically resolves quickly. Monitor for excessive or prolonged redness and advise gentle post-treatment care; evaluate further if concerns persist.
